95871786751104 is an even composite number. It is composed of eight dist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, five hundred thirty-six divisors.

Prime factorization of 95871786751104:

27 × 3 × 7 × 13 × 172 × 19 × 61 × 8191

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 7 × 13 × 17 × 17 × 19 × 61 × 8191)
